On Wednesday 8/5/2019, an award ceremony was successfully held in the events hall of the Technical Chamber of Greece – Western Macedonia Section (TEE/TDM), presented by members of its Steering Committee. The event honoured the male and female students of the Mechanical Engineering Department at the Polytechnic School of the University of Western Macedonia, who participated in the student team of Typhoon MotoRacing and in the design, analysis, and construction of the multi-award-winning racing motorcycle “Chimera”.
The event was opened by the President of the Steering Committee of TEE/TDM, Mr Dimitris Mavromatidis who emphasised that the future bodes brilliantly for the current students and tomorrow's graduate engineers of the Mechanical Engineering Department at the Polytechnic School of the University of Western Macedonia following their award-winning achievements.
The team's scientific supervisor, Assistant Professor Mr Dimitris Giagopoulos spoke about the Typhoon MotoRacing team, which was created in 2014 by students from the mechanical engineering school of the University of Western Macedonia. Last year (October 2018), the team participated in the international Motostudent V competition in Aragon, Spain, with the prototype “Chimera”, a Moto3-type racing motorcycle, achieving 7th place in the overall standings among 45 university teams, which included top polytechnic institutions in Europe, with numerous awards for the mechanical and design aspect, the structural analysis, and its innovation.

Finally, on behalf of the Typhoon MotoRacing student team, its leader, Mr Efthymios Papas, pointed out that the 21 students who participated last year in the design, analysis, and construction of the “Chimera” racing motorcycle have created sub-groups to perfect their project, a 250cc racing motorcycle. Each group has a specific goal regarding the study and development of the engine, chassis, electrics, suspension, brakes, and aerodynamics, with the ultimate objective being the future industrialisation of the motorcycle and the creation of a final product suitable for the road.
